POPULAR AVAILABLE TREATMENTS :

A) "DHT Inhibitor" like 'Finasteride', Popular brand available in India is Finex.

Read more about it here en.m.wikipedia.org/wiki/Baldness for its effects and some possible side effects.
Cost: Dr Reddy Finax (1mg) 30 Tablet strip will cost you Rs.123.90 or Rs. 4.13 per tablet, But you can cut this cost to 1/4th by buying similar Finasteride of some other brand and cutting the pill by 1/4 (in 4 parts), (google for pill cutter or knife just do fine)

Explanation on (Cost Cutting) : West Coast Pharmaceuticals sell the same 'Finasteride' with the name of 'Growvita' in (5 mg) per tablet packing strip of 10 tablets for just Rs. 32 so per 5mg tablet will cost you 3.20. Now cut this tablet into 4 and you will get 1.25mg for just 80 Paise or less then a Rupee.

But to get these brands you have to be aware and persistent with your Chemist & Doctor, As most of them want to sell expensive brands first.

Also few paragraph below I have explained how to search similar and less costlier medicine.

B) Minoxidil 5% (topical solution) mainly for stimulating hair fossils.

Cost: It Cost a lot comparatively, cheapest I can find is by 'Ranbaxy' with name of 'Amenxildil' (60 ml) Lotion with composition of (Minoxidil- 5% w/w Aminixil-1 .5% w/w) for Rs. 390

C) Ketoconazole-2 % based shampoo for it's anti fungal properties. it's DHT or hair stimulation property is not accepted by FDA yet.

Cost: There are lot of options, but again cheapest I could find by 'Psychotropics India Limited' with the name of 'Dancure' (Skin) (50ml) Shampoo with the composition of (Ketoconazole-2 % Zinc Pyrithionone(ZPTO) -1 %) for Rs. 65

D) Supplements or Vitamin / Mineral tablets like 'Folliderm' , 'Xtraglo' or 'Follihair'  for biotin, selenium, zinc & copper clubbed with zincovit for Vitamin B12, B6, D3, Iron and so on..

Cost: Folliderm is 10 Tablets for Rs. 66 or Rs. 6.60 per tablet and Zincovit is 10 Tablets for Rs. 33 or Rs. 3.30 per tablet.
Though I found "Oxivim" a less costly option as in around 4.50 Rs. It give me combination of 'Folliderm' and 'Zincovit'. Or 'Skinvit' for Rs. 3.50 along with 'Supradyn' which is for Only Rs. 1 per tablet, Also you have to take just 1 tablet instead of 2 so to me it's look like a better option but some doctor need to confirm this.

Well there might be more better and less costly solutions out there, If we come together and discuss it more openly with our doctors and here.

Read point A, B, C and D again. That's all the Dermatologist in india priscribe to hair loss patients for treatments or may be that's all available to poor mortals , Until unless you are Salman Khan ;-)

Brand name of the medicine changes but the basic composition remain same. So guys evaluate your Doctor's priscription first before getting into some money trap.

Listing some common terminology printed on medicines.

Weight/volume (w/v%) and volume/volume (v/v%) basis
EXAMPLE “5% w/v ” means 5 g of the solute dissolved in 100 ml of the solvent.
(q.s.) means On a prescription, as needed or Used as per requirement.

Cobalamin means Vitamin B12 Vitamin B6 is Pyridoxine and Vitamin H is called Biotin or Vitamin B7(see complete list below)

mg= milligram mcg= micrograms g= gram kg= kilogram
1000 microgram = 1 milligram = .001 gram

  3. Thanks for the comment Sailesh,

    Mainly this article was on the basis of availability/cost/value and FDA/Indian Medical Association (IMC) approved drugs/medicine's.
    Hence I avoided the herbal or alternate treatments which has no scientific test or data to prove it's effectiveness.

    Saw palmetto and Stinging Nettle is not regulated or approved by FDA, which means that not enough scientific studies are carried out to prove the claimed benefits of this herbal remedy. As a result, whatever benefits are stated are only traditionally believed and incorporated by alternate medicine practitioners.

    Apart from that a dose of 500mg per day for Saw Palmetto and around 300mg per day for Stinging Nettle is recommended for Hair loss.
    Hard to find those kind of doses from a responsible company in a decent affordable price.

    That is why I've listed only FDA approved (Finasteride or Propecia/Proscar) which are certified (DHT Inhibitor's) Or a (5 alpha-reductase inhibitor of the type II isoenzyme) which works by binding to 5-alpha-reductase, the enzyme responsible for the conversion of free testosterone to DHT.
    This helps to fight 'male pattern baldness (MPB)' or 'Androgenic alopecia' or 'ben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H)' a medical condition which is responsible for hair loss.

    For people who are interested in alternative medicine.
    I've already listed two names, see my post above for 'RADIANCE-H soft-gelatin Capsule' and 'NAVTIC Tablet' but the portions/required dosage of the requested herbs are too low in these in order to be really affective on hairloss.
